The landscape of modern mathematics is undergoing a profound evolution, characterized as a "technological turn" that alters both the creation of mathematical knowledge and the social structures supporting it. Driven by advancements in artificial intelligence for mathematics, this shift centers on tools like Interactive Theorem Provers (ITPs) and neural large language models (LLMs). 

Traditionally, mathematical communities rely on peer review to verify informal proofs, yet the increasing complexity of contemporary research challenges human scrutiny. ITPs mitigate human fallibility by translating informal mathematical concepts into strict formal languages for computer verification. While these software platforms drastically heighten certainty, they introduce unique vulnerabilities, such as latent translation defects between intuitive reasoning and formal execution.

Beyond individual verification, this technological integration fundamentally reshapes collaborative research dynamics, replacing traditional interpersonal trust with algorithmic verification. This shift enables large-scale, asynchronous, and modular crowdsourcing projects, effectively forming hybrid epistemic networks that combine human intelligence with specialized software tools. Concurrently, the rise of neural architectures and neurosymbolic systems pushes automated reasoning to competitive heights, as demonstrated by automated medal-level solutions to Olympiad problems and the discovery of novel mathematical conjectures.


 However, this deployment sparks serious concerns regarding systemic errors, intellectual property rights, environmental sustainability, and the potential decline of core human competencies. Ultimately, understanding these complex interactions between human minds and machine capabilities remains critical as automated theorem proving and digital collaboration platforms permanently reshape the parameters of rigorous mathematical inquiry.
